William T. Netta, R.A.

Vice President, Pettinaro Construction Co., Inc.

Bill joined Pettinaro in 2005 bringing 30 years of experience in the field of architecture, construction, and professional registration in Delaware, Maryland, and Pennsylvania. He oversees the architecture department and is responsible for all aspects of design projects. To date, he is responsible for the design of a dozen minor league baseball stadiums; several million square feet of office facilities; and many retail, housing, and educational facilities. He continues to receive accolades for his work, including numerous design and construction awards.

Bill's projects have ranged from small retail "mom and pops" to 250K SF Class 'A' office buildings as well as 6,000 seat baseball stadium for Cal Ripken, Jr. He is customer service oriented and prides himself on the quality and timeliness of his finished products.

Bill graduated cum laude from Spring Garden College with a Bachelor of Science degree in Architecture. During that time he was awarded multiple professional and interscholastic design awards.

An active community volunteer, Bill has worked for Habitat for Humanity, Special Olympics Delaware, and has served on the technical advisory committee for the Brandywine School District STEM (Science, Technology, Engineering & Math) program.
